Transaction 11fa77261fff55affc5e49d5aabd25ff0a8d4f0e725da36d63b3ae88aff74403
1 Input
2 Outputs
- 11fa77261fff55affc5e49d5aabd25ff0a8d4f0e725da36d63b3ae88aff74403:0
- 11fa77261fff55affc5e49d5aabd25ff0a8d4f0e725da36d63b3ae88aff74403:1
value 903633
address 18Re8ZYVK6CtFj6oB8B4uQ3v2PZVhHK8QY
value 702522419
address 1Q5ZRANQtvmFLUzfJTd56iBCdjgbQonALJ